USB Connectors
USB connectors is a connector developed to offer easy connections to host computers, peripherals, or other devices for data and power. USB connectors come in all shapes and sizes, from the type A, type B and type C connectors used to connect larger devices such as monitors and printers, to the micro and mini versions commonly used for integrated devices like smartphones, tablets, and cameras. The most common types are the type A and type B connectors, with type A being used for the USB host or “upstream” connection, and type B being used for the USB devices or “downstream” connection.
The type A and type B connectors are the standard for data transfer between devices and computers. The larger USB Type A plug connectors are used in host computers, printing devices, and other peripherals to connect to USB cables. The smaller USB type B plug connectors are commonly found on other devices such as computer mice, keyboards, digital cameras, and digital camcorders. In addition, there are several variations of USB type mini and micro plugs and receptacles that are used for integration of mobile devices like smartphones, tablets, and digital audio players with USB devices.
The USB connector allows for two-way data transfer and power supply, as well as hot swapping devices. This means that the host computer can send and receive data over the same connection. Power can be supplied through the USB connection, as well as between devices to support charging, or to power smaller devices such as phones and mp3 players. Hot swapping allows devices to be added or removed from a USB connection without restarting the computer or disrupting the data transfer. USB connectors are also widely used in commercial and consumer electronics because they are small, durable, and provide a reliable connection.
